Erdoğan “No initiative that ignores the sovereign equality, rights and legitimate interests of Turkish Cypriots, will succeed”
Erdoğan: No initiative ignoring Turkish Cypriot rights will succeed
President of the Republic of Türkiye Recep Tayyip Erdoğan addressed the nation at the Presidential Complex following a Cabinet meeting in the capital, Ankara.
President Erdoğan stated that no initiative undermining Turkish Cypriots’ sovereign equality, rights and legitimate interests will succeed.
He also welcomed UN Secretary-General Antonio Guterres’ recent visit to the island, saying Türkiye has consistently supported his peace efforts and will remain in close consultation with him.
Recalling last week’s commemoration marking the 52nd anniversary of the 1974 Cyprus Peace Operation, Erdoğan described July 20, 1974, as “a historic turning point” that secured the existence, freedom and security of Turkish Cypriots. He said that Türkiye, acting under its rights and responsibilities as a guarantor power in accordance with international agreements, had ended the suffering of Turkish Cypriots and helped establish of peace and stability on the island.
Peace on the island through a fair, durable and sustainable settlement.
Erdoğan also argued that proposals aimed at reducing Turkish Cypriots to minority status have repeatedly failed in the past, adding that lasting peace on the island can only be achieved through a fair, durable and sustainable settlement.
Reaffirming that Türkiye’s longstanding support for Turkish Cypriots, Erdoğan said, “Türkiye will never abandon its Turkish Cypriot brothers and will never allow the suffering of the past to be repeated, whatever the cost.”
Highlighting expanding cooperation with the Turkish Republic of Northern Cyprus (TRNC) in areas including tourism, higher education, technology and digital transformation, President Erdoğan said that, following the completion of the undersea water pipeline project, Türkiye plans to advance further strategic initiatives, including the construction of undersea natural gas pipeline linking Türkiye and the TRNC.
